Como criar visualizações no Excel que competem com o Power BI sem sair da planilha

O Power BI é frequentemente apresentado como a ferramenta ideal para quem precisa de visualizações de dados profissionais e dashboards interativos, e o Excel como a planilha de todos os dias para cálculos e tabelas. Mas essa distinção está ficando cada vez mais borrada. Com os recursos mais recentes do Excel 365, é possível criar visualizações de dados tão impactantes e interativas quanto as do Power BI, sem sair do ambiente de planilha que a maioria das pessoas já conhece. Neste artigo iremos mostrar quais recursos do Excel tornam isso possível e como aplicá-los.

Gráficos do Excel com Python: visualizações de nível profissional

A integração do Python no Excel com a função =PY() abriu uma porta enorme para visualizações avançadas. As bibliotecas Matplotlib e Seaborn do Python produzem gráficos de qualidade muito superior aos gráficos nativos do Excel. Histogramas com curva de densidade, box plots para análise de distribuição, heatmaps para identificar padrões em matrizes de dados, gráficos de violino para comparação de distribuições — todos esses tipos de visualização que o Excel nativo não consegue criar estão disponíveis com Python dentro da planilha.

A diferença visual entre um gráfico nativo do Excel e um gráfico do Seaborn com tema personalizado é considerável. Os gráficos do Seaborn têm paletas de cores cientificamente desenvolvidas para facilitar a percepção visual de dados, tipografia mais limpa e elementos visuais mais elegantes. Para quem precisa criar relatórios visualmente impressionantes sem sair do Excel, essa combinação de Python com Excel é um divisor de águas que está sendo muito comentado por analistas de dados e profissionais de BI.

Um exemplo prático: um heatmap de correlação entre variáveis, que é uma das visualizações mais usadas em análise de dados para identificar quais indicadores se movem juntos, pode ser criado em poucas linhas de Python dentro do Excel. O código usa o pandas para calcular a matriz de correlação e o seaborn para criar o heatmap colorido com os valores de cada correlação exibidos dentro das células do gráfico. O resultado é incorporado diretamente na planilha como uma imagem de alta resolução, pronta para ser usada em qualquer apresentação.

Gráficos interativos com Plotly dentro do Excel

Além do Matplotlib e do Seaborn, que geram imagens estáticas, a função =PY() também suporta o Plotly, que é uma biblioteca de visualização que cria gráficos interativos. Quando você usa o Plotly dentro da função =PY() no Excel, o resultado que aparece na planilha é um gráfico interativo onde você pode passar o mouse para ver os valores exatos, dar zoom em regiões específicas, clicar em elementos da legenda para mostrar ou ocultar séries de dados e muito mais.

Essa interatividade é exatamente o que torna o Power BI tão valorioso, e agora está disponível dentro do Excel para quem tem acesso ao Python integrado. Um gráfico de linhas interativo com múltiplas séries de tempo onde o usuário pode fazer zoom no período mais relevante, um gráfico de barras onde clicar em uma barra filtra os outros gráficos, ou um scatter plot onde passar o mouse sobre cada ponto revela o nome do item e os valores de ambos os eixos — tudo isso é possível com Plotly dentro da função =PY().

Para criar um gráfico Plotly interativo dentro do Excel, o código Python seria algo como: importar plotly.express, criar a figura com as funções do Plotly, configurar o layout e retornar a figura. O Excel incorpora o gráfico interativo diretamente na célula. Esse nível de interatividade, que antes era exclusivo de ferramentas de BI como Power BI e Tableau, agora está disponível diretamente no ambiente de planilha do Excel, eliminando a necessidade de migrar para outra ferramenta para projetos que precisam de visuais interativos.

Formatação condicional avançada para visualizações sem gráficos

Além dos gráficos tradicionais, o Excel tem recursos de formatação condicional que criam visualizações de dados diretamente nas células, sem precisar de gráficos separados. As barras de dados, as escalas de cores e os conjuntos de ícones transformam tabelas de números em mapas visuais que comunicam padrões de dados de forma imediata e intuitiva.

As escalas de cores, por exemplo, aplicam um gradiente de cor nas células de acordo com os valores, do vermelho (valores baixos) ao verde (valores altos), passando pelo amarelo no meio. Para uma tabela de desempenho de vendedores por mês, uma escala de cores transforma instantaneamente uma tabela de números em um heatmap visual onde os meses e vendedores de melhor e pior desempenho saltam aos olhos sem que o leitor precise analisar cada número individualmente.

Os conjuntos de ícones adicionam pequenos símbolos coloridos (setas, semáforos, estrelas, bandeiras) dentro das células de acordo com regras que você define. Um semáforo verde, amarelo e vermelho ao lado de cada KPI é uma das visualizações mais usadas em dashboards executivos e que o Excel consegue criar nativamente com os conjuntos de ícones da formatação condicional, sem nenhuma imagem externa ou add-in adicional.

Sparklines: minigráficos dentro das células para tendências rápidas

Os Sparklines são minigráficos inseridos diretamente dentro de células do Excel, perfeitos para mostrar tendências de um indicador ao longo do tempo em um espaço mínimo. Uma tabela com doze colunas de meses e uma coluna de Sparklines ao final comunica de forma muito mais rápida a tendência de cada linha do que uma tabela apenas com números, sem precisar de um gráfico separado que ocupa muito espaço na planilha.

O Excel tem três tipos de Sparklines: linha (para tendências ao longo do tempo), coluna (para comparações de valores) e ganhos/perdas (para mostrar valores positivos e negativos). Para inserir, selecione a célula onde o Sparkline vai aparecer, vá em Inserir e escolha o tipo de Sparkline. Depois selecione o intervalo de dados que o minigráfico vai representar. Em segundos, a célula exibe um pequeno gráfico com a tendência dos dados selecionados.

Para dashboards executivos onde o espaço é limitado e você precisa mostrar muitas informações em uma única tela, os Sparklines são uma ferramenta poderosa. Uma tabela com dez vendedores, seus totais mensais e um Sparkline de linha mostrando a tendência dos últimos doze meses em uma única célula ao lado do nome comunica muito mais informação de forma mais eficiente do que dez gráficos separados. Essa abordagem de visualização compacta e de alta densidade de informação é o que profissionais de visualização de dados chamam de “small multiples”, uma técnica consagrada que o Excel suporta nativamente com os Sparklines.

Se você curtiu esse artigo onde mostramos como criar visualizações no Excel que competem com o Power BI, compartilhe com as suas redes sociais e não se esqueça de deixar um comentário aqui embaixo caso você tenha ficado com alguma dúvida.

DOMINE EXCEL COMIGO

QUERO APRENDER EXCEL

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*